Reverberatory

Reverberatory A reverberatory, or air furnace, is a furnace in which ore, metal, or other material is, exposed to the action of flame, but not to the contact of burning fuel. The flame passes over a bridge and then downward upon the material spread upon the hearth. Such furnaces are extensively used in shops where heavy work is being executed.

What are reverberating furnace?

What are reverberating furnace?

Which reactions occur in reverberatory furnace? Reverberatory furnace is generally used in the extraction process of copper, tin and nickel production. So the reaction taking place in the reverberatory furnace is: 2C{u_2}S + 3{O_2} to 2C{u_2}O + 2S{O_2}. Oxygen is passed through the copper ore converting cuprous sulphide to cuprous oxide.

Reverberatory Furnace

Reverberatory furnace, a furnace used for smelting or refining in which the fuel is not in direct contact with the ore but heats it by a flame blown over it from another chamber. The term reverberation is used here in a generic sense of rebounding or reflecting, not in the acoustic sense of echoing. Such furnace is used in COPPER, TIN, and NICKEL production, in the .

Iron ore (fines)

Iron Ore (fines) Iron ores are rocks and minerals from which metallic iron can be economically extracted. The ores are usually rich in iron oxides and vary in colour from dark grey, bright yellow, deep purple, to rusty red. The iron itself is usually found in the form of magnetite (Fe 3 O 4 ), hematite (Fe 2 O 3 ), goethite (FeO (OH)), limonite ...

Refractory materials for Blast furnaces

A blast furnace is a type of metallurgical furnace used for smelting to produce industrial metals, generally iron. In a blast furnace, fuel and ore are continuously supplied through the top of the furnace, while air (sometimes with oxygen enrichment) is blown into the bottom of the chamber, so that the chemical reactions take place throughout the furnace as the material moves .
